Java Developer Trainee Resume
2.00/5 (Submit Your Rating)
New York, NY
TECHNICAL SKILLS
- Java SE1.6, Eclipse, JUnit, Maven
- XMLDOM
- Java EEServlets, JSPs, Tomcat, JDBC, JPA, Spring
- UMLVisual Paradigm UML
- C++/C#Visual Studio .Net
- VC ToolsSVN
- SQLOracle 10g
- VerilogCadence
- UNIXvi editor, shell scripting
PROFESSIONAL EXPERIENCE
Confidential, New York, NY
Java Developer Trainee
Responsibilities:
- Completed a Java training program focusing on Java, Java EE, Unix, SQL, and Design Patterns.
- Worked in an AGILE team of developers to plan, design, and implement, a trading platform web application in Java, utilizing Java Server Pages (JSPs), Servlets, Spring MVC and AOP.
- Database storage and connectivity using Oracle JDBC.
- Used Unix shell scripting to create a safe rm command dat persists deleted files to a recycle bin.
- Created complex SQL queries to extract data from a trading platform database.
- Knowledge of various design patterns such as Factory, Singleton, Command, Object Pool, Decorator, Observer, etc.
C++/C# Visual Studio .Net, OrCAD, C: USB Photometer
Confidential
Responsibilities:
- Designed and built an affordable USB powered light meter with graphical Windows software using a Cypress USB microcontroller and C++/C# Microsoft Visual Studio .Net.
- Designed and created a hardware circuit with photodiode, trans - impedance amplifier, gain circuit, analog-to-digital converter (ADC), digital-to-analog converter (DAC), microcontroller, and USB port.
- Used OrCAD to create a PCB layout.
- Created USB device drivers.
- Device functionality controlled via Windows Forms application.
- Displayed light intensity readings via a graph.
Ethernet Network Interface
Confidential
Responsibilities:
- Designed an Ethernet network Interface using Verilog and Xilinx Field Programmable Gate Arrays (FPGA).
- Designed data packet format and TEMPeffectively route them between FPGAs and teh Ethernet Bus with collision detection and cyclic redundancy check (CRC) for data validation.UNIX: Safe RM Project
- Use shell scripting to create a safe rm command dat persists deleted files to a recycle bin.
Java
Confidential
Responsibilities:
- Design, code and test teh classes dat constitute teh model and controller portions of teh project.
- Provide multiple options for data persistence: XML file storage using (SAX/DOM parsers), and Oracle JDBC connectivity.
- Incorporate teh model classes into a web application, utilizing Java Server Pages (JSP) and Servlets.
- Further develop teh web application to incorporate Spring MVC and AOP.
- Finally, continue teh development of teh application as a group following Agile development methodologies and teh Scrum process.